Best CAM Software for CNC Turning for Complex Part Programming
Selecting the best CAM software for CNC turning is essential for manufacturers working with complex part programming.
In modern manufacturing, precision and efficiency are essential, especially when dealing with complex geometries in CNC turning operations. Computer-Aided Manufacturing (CAM) software plays a critical role in converting CAD designs into accurate machining instructions for CNC machines. Choosing the best CAM software for CNC turning can significantly improve productivity, reduce errors, and optimize toolpaths for intricate components.
This article explores the top capabilities, benefits, and features of CAM solutions designed specifically for CNC turning applications, particularly when handling complex part programming requirements.
Advanced Toolpath Generation for Complex Geometries
The foundation of any powerful CAM system is its ability to generate accurate and efficient toolpaths. For CNC turning, especially with complex parts, this becomes even more critical as the geometry often includes curves, undercuts, and multi-axis operations.
Modern CAM tools help machinists automate toolpath creation while maintaining precision and consistency across operations. The best CAM software for CNC turning ensures smooth cutting strategies that minimize tool wear and machining time.
Key points:
- Automatic roughing and finishing toolpath generation
- Support for multi-axis and sub-spindle turning operations
- Optimized tool engagement for complex geometries
- Reduced cycle times through intelligent path planning
Efficient toolpath generation not only improves accuracy but also enhances machine performance. By simulating machining processes before execution, operators can avoid costly mistakes and ensure smooth production workflows.
Advanced algorithms also help detect collisions and inefficiencies, allowing engineers to refine machining strategies early in the planning stage. This leads to better surface finish quality and higher production reliability.
High-Level Simulation and Verification Features
Simulation is a crucial part of CNC turning, especially when working with complex components. It allows manufacturers to visualize the entire machining process before actual production begins, reducing risks and improving accuracy.
The best CAM software for CNC turning provides real-time simulation that mimics actual machine behavior, including tool movement, spindle rotation, and material removal.
Key points:
- Real-time 3D machining simulation
- Collision detection between tools and workpieces
- Machine-specific behavior modeling
- Verification of toolpaths before production
With advanced simulation tools, engineers can identify potential issues such as tool interference, overcutting, or inefficient machining paths. This significantly reduces scrap rates and downtime.
Furthermore, simulation ensures that even highly complex parts can be machined with confidence, as operators can validate every step of the process before sending it to the CNC machine.
Seamless CAD Integration and Data Handling
Efficient CNC turning workflows rely heavily on seamless integration between CAD and CAM systems. This ensures that design changes are quickly translated into updated machining instructions without delays or errors.
The best CAM software for CNC turning supports direct CAD file import and allows real-time synchronization between design and manufacturing teams.
Key points:
- Direct import of CAD files (STEP, IGES, STL, etc.)
- Bidirectional updates between CAD and CAM systems
- Automatic feature recognition for machining
- Efficient handling of complex part models
Strong CAD-CAM integration reduces manual programming efforts and minimizes the risk of data translation errors. This is especially important in industries like aerospace and automotive, where precision is non-negotiable.
It also enables faster prototyping and production cycles, allowing manufacturers to respond quickly to design changes and customer requirements.
Multi-Axis Machining and Automation Support
As manufacturing evolves, multi-axis CNC turning has become a standard for producing complex parts. CAM software must support advanced machining strategies that go beyond traditional 2-axis operations.
The best CAM software for CNC turning provides full support for multi-axis machining, enabling manufacturers to produce intricate components in a single setup.
Key points:
- Support for 3-axis, 4-axis, and 5-axis turning operations
- Automated tool selection and setup optimization
- Reduced manual intervention in programming
- Integration with robotic automation systems
Multi-axis capabilities significantly reduce setup time and improve machining accuracy by minimizing repositioning errors. This results in faster production and higher consistency across batches.
Automation features further streamline operations by reducing human intervention, making manufacturing processes more efficient and scalable for large production environments.
Optimization and Efficiency in Production Workflows
Efficiency is a major factor in CNC turning operations, especially when dealing with high-volume or complex part production. CAM software helps optimize machining parameters to improve speed, quality, and cost-effectiveness.
The best CAM software for CNC turning includes advanced optimization tools that enhance tool life, reduce cycle times, and improve surface finish quality.
Key points:
- Intelligent feed rate and spindle speed optimization
- Tool wear prediction and management
- Batch processing for repeated part production
- Energy-efficient machining strategies
By optimizing machining parameters, manufacturers can significantly reduce production costs while maintaining high-quality output. This is particularly valuable in competitive industries where margins are tight.
In addition, predictive tools help schedule maintenance and reduce unexpected machine downtime, ensuring continuous production flow and improved operational efficiency.
Conclusion
Selecting the best CAM software for CNC turning is essential for manufacturers working with complex part programming. From advanced toolpath generation and simulation to CAD integration and multi-axis machining, modern CAM systems provide all the tools needed to improve precision and efficiency.
By leveraging these capabilities, manufacturers can reduce errors, optimize production workflows, and achieve higher-quality results. In today’s fast-paced manufacturing environment, investing in the right CAM software is not just an option—it is a necessity for staying competitive and delivering complex components with confidence.


